The European countries exported over 1.82 million tons of goods, worth $2.333 billion to Iran during the first four months of current Iranian fiscal year (March 20-July 20).
The Islamic Republic's imports from the Europe registered an increase by 41 percent in terms of volume and 25 percent in terms of value respectively compared the same period of last year, according to the latest statistics released by Trade Promotion Organization of Iran (TPOI).
Organization of Islamic Cooperation (OIC) took a dominant share from Iran’s imports during the 4-month period. Tehran imported some 2.5 million tons of goods, worth $3.334 billion from the OIC countries during the 4-month period.
The mentioned amount is 33 and 15 percent less in terms of volume and value respectively, compared the same period of last fiscal year(March 20-July 20, 2015).
